129: Chapter 96: Li Ruoxi’s Cunning Plan, The Secrets of the True Martial Department (Please Subscribe)_3 129: Chapter 96: Li Ruoxi’s Cunning Plan, The Secrets of the True Martial Department (Please Subscribe)_3 At this moment, quite a few new students were here to collect contribution points.

Of course, aside from new students, there were also many returning students and instructors present.

Everyone at Guang Han Martial University could exchange cultivation resources here.

As soon as Xu Zhou and Li Ruoxi entered, they immediately drew everyone’s attention.

“It’s the top new student!”

“Quite handsome, isn’t he?”

“The top new student this year doesn’t seem to be from any major family’s direct lineage…”

The surrounding new and old students were discussing.

Xu Zhou remained calm, but Li Tie beside him was a bit upset.

He was top-ranked too, so why was no one paying attention to him?

Everyone was focused on Xu Zhou!

Just because Xu Zhou was more handsome?

Is being handsome all that impressive?

Li Tie was a bit jealous, but he quickly realized that receiving such attention might not be a good thing.

“It’s a pity he entered the True Martial Department.”

“Those guys from the Liu Family will probably cause trouble for him soon.”

A few informed students whispered.

Evidently, they were aware of the conflict between the Divine Martial Department and the True Martial Department.

Most students at Guang Han Martial University weren’t unaware of this, only some geniuses from the Divine Martial Department knew a little of the inside story.

At this moment, the few people looking at Xu Zhou had a slightly playful expression in their eyes.

Xu Zhou didn’t mind the others’ gazes and quietly stood in line.

Soon, it was Xu Zhou and Li Tie’s turn.

At the counter was the same middle-aged man as before.

Xu Zhou stepped forward and said: “Teacher, I’m here to claim contribution points.”

“Room card, please.” The middle-aged man sat by the computer, not raising his head.

Xu Zhou and Li Tie immediately handed over their room cards.

The middle-aged man took the room cards and inserted one into the nearby card reader, then looked at the computer.

“Li Tie, student number 217563, contribution points…”

He paused slightly, then suddenly his eyes widened in surprise: “Contribution points, 186 points?”

“186 points?” Xu Zhou was also a bit surprised.

According to Dean Zhou Xuyun’s explanation, defeating a team would earn 1 contribution point.

The first place would receive an extra 100 points.

They had defeated 36 teams.

Calculating like this, it should be 136 points.

But 186 points?

Where did the extra 50 points come from?

He was surprised, but the middle-aged man was even more surprised.

He looked up at Li Tie and asked: “Are you the top new student this year?”

Li Tie coughed and pointed to Xu Zhou, saying: “Most of the effort came from my teammate.”

Upon hearing this, the middle-aged teacher immediately inserted Xu Zhou’s room card.

“Xu Zhou…” The middle-aged man nodded and said: “No wonder, the new king of this year’s newcomers?”

Xu Zhou nodded helplessly, not expecting this teacher to have heard of his name too.

“No wonder.” The middle-aged man took a deep breath and praised: “Not bad, 186 points, this surpasses many of the previous years’ top new students!”

In previous new student assessments, additional points were also awarded under certain rules.

But reaching 186 points was quite rare.

This student in front of him was clearly exceptionally talented.

Xu Zhou asked in confusion: “Teacher, why is there an additional 50 contribution points?”

“Each new student receives a bonus of 50 contribution points upon entry.” The middle-aged man’s attitude improved significantly.

Xu Zhou realized, understanding now why it made sense.

If they didn’t pass the assessment, 50 contribution points would be deducted, effectively canceling out the gifted 50 points.

This didn’t mean they owed the school 500,000, just that they would start at a lower point than others.

Soon, Li Tie also finished collecting his contribution points, which was also 186 points.

Xu Zhou looked at the middle-aged man and asked: “What can we exchange for with the school’s contribution points?”

“There are plenty of options.” The middle-aged man smiled and said: “Contribution points are the sole currency at Guang Han Martial University.”

“You can exchange them for numerous precious cultivation resources, such as advanced cultivation potions, beast cores, and so on.”

“Similarly, you can exchange them for weapons, battle armor, and more.

As long as Guang Han Martial University has it, you can practically exchange it for contribution points.”

“Of course, these are the most common uses.”

“If you have enough contribution points, you can even hire senior students to help you complete certain tasks, and with even more, some instructors can do things for you.”

The middle-aged man smiled and said: “In short, contribution points are extremely important and indispensable for all members of Martial Arts University.”

Xu Zhou was somewhat shocked.

Contribution points could even make instructors do tasks for you?

He knew that those instructors were at least fifth-grade or sixth-grade.

In Xu Zhou’s eyes, they were already unimaginably powerful figures, getting them to do things for him?

Absolutely incredible!

“Of course,” the middle-aged man added: “If you want an instructor to help you, it would cost at least 5,000 contribution points.”

“5,000 contribution points?” Xu Zhou’s eyes widened.

1 contribution point was equal to 10,000 Federation Coins.

5,000 contribution points were 50 million!

Well, it seems he wouldn’t be arranging for an instructor to do things for him anytime soon.

Previously, Xu Zhou did have the idea of having an instructor serve him tea and water, to experience the life of a young master.

But now it seems…

forget it!

Beside him, Li Tie asked: “Teacher, is there an exchange list?”

“Yes.” The middle-aged man nodded.

He took out a tablet, and the screen projected directly into the air.

Soon, a projection appeared in the air.

[Advanced Cultivation Potion: 8 Contribution/each]

[Tier 1 Level 4 Beast Core: 1 Contribution/each]

[Tier 1 Level 5 Beast Core: 3 Contribution/each]

[Tier 1 Level 6 Beast Core: 6 Contribution/each]

[E-Class 400 Model Battle Armor: 80 Contribution]

[E-Class 500 Model Battle Armor: 100 Contribution]

[E-Class 400 Model Weapon: 60 Contribution]

[E-Class 500 Model Weapon: 80 Contribution]

The exchange catalog was extensive and comprehensive, and Xu Zhou and Li Tie browsed through a myriad of items.

However, Xu Zhou soon noticed: “Advanced Cultivation Potion for 8 contribution points a bottle?”

That’s 80,000 coins each.
